The invention concerns a lighter-than-air craft for transporting by air equipment and passengers, more particularly, it concerns an aircraft whereof the frame (1) made of light metal and erected vertically, contains and protects the passenger compartment (4) of the invention, and all the components of the invention which, by a mass-reducing assembly (2-8-9-11-19), uses light gas power for neutralizing the earth's gravitational pull. Electric motors actuating propellers (6-7) with multiple blades and powered by a mini-electric power unit (5) enable to counter the force of mean winds, so to lift the neutralized mass and control the aircraft movements. The aircraft wide external surfaces (11-12) are used as wing system, a sailboat keel being replaced by a gyroscope (10) stabilizing effect and by the thrust of the lateral propellers (6). The invention which concerns a novel, safe, silent and economical form of air travel is designed for limited passenger and goods transport, for tourist sightseeing, exploring, observing and multimedia advertising display.

1. A craft using lighter-than-air gas to transport by air material and passengers, which comprisesa framework enclosing in the upper part of its structure, balloons inflated with a lighter-than-air gas and held by cables hooked to the framework which they grip and pull away from the gravitional force; a cabin with bulletproof windows for the pilot and passengers set on the base of the framework; a mini power station which supplies electricity to the equipments and accessories of the craft; propellents placed inside long tubular passages for concentrated air thrust, used to lift the neutralized mass of the craft and to move it in the air space; a compressor system which injects in the balloons or retrieves from the balloons a calculated quantity of lighter-than-air gas stored in a slightly pressurized tank according to the total mass of the craft to be neutralized or to partially restore; a stabilizer system to eliminate rolls and sways and a protection system consisting of balloons inflated with lighter-than-air gas, molded over the total exteror surface of the framework, and, a cover covering all the framework made of a fabric resistant to tears and small projectiles?excluding the passenger compartment. 2. The lighter-than-air craft of claim 1 wherein the framework of the craft represents a rectangular structure or extended cubical erected vertically which extremities seen from above form a square or a diamond pattern and which front of the craft is formed by the meeting point of two of the sides of the framework and the extension of these sides which allow the exterior envelope covering this surface of the framework both to cut facing winds and expose at proper angle said surfaces as sails to oncoming winds.3. The lighter-than-air craft of claim 1 wherein the framework of the craft consists of and is mounted around male or female connection corners which receive and link the horizontal cross-overs, the diagonal cross sections and the vertical pylons at each level of the framework to be solidly screwed and riveted together to facilitate mounting, dismantling and repair of the overall structure.4. The lighter-than-air craft of claim 1 wherein said protection system further includesa double exterior envelope consisting of said molded balloons, inflated with lighter-than-air gas, covering the exterior surface of the framework in exclusion of the cabin and a fabric resistant to tears and small projectiles covering and protecting all the exterior surfaces of the craft ?in exclusion of the cabin. 5. The lighter-than-air craft of claim 1 wherein the exterior envelope covering the exterior molded balloons attached to the framework serves as sail surfaces for the craft to exploit winds.6. The lighter-than-air craft of claim 1 wherein the mini electric power station has as initial source of energy the drive shaft of a liquid fuel engine geared to a series of alternators which energy production after transformation, supply electricity to the propellents, the compressor system, the stabilizer motor and the other electrically powered accessories of the said craft.7. The lighter-than-air craft of claim 1 wherein the horizontally oriented propellents and the vertically oriented propellents are powerful electric motors turning multiblade propellers placed inside long tubular passages allowing at the exit a concentrated air thrust.8. The lighter-than-air craft of claim 1 wherein the vertically oriented propellents(7) inserted in long tubular passages are placed inside each vertical pylons of the framework their exit being close to the base and the top of the framework; and, the horizontally oriented propellents inserted in long tubular passages are positioned at the top of the framework and above the cabin along the left and right frontal surface of the craft.9. The lighter-than-air craft of claim 1 wherein the stabilizer system is a gyroscope activated by a variable speed electric motor and set on an horizontal plane inside the framework between the machine floor and the ceiling of the cabin to eliminate uncomfortable sways and rolls of the craft and activated or disactivated in relation with the intended pilot maneuvers.10. The lighter-than-air craft of claim 1, wherein the molded balloons are permanently inflated and fitted to the exterior of the framework and the cover is also exterior to the molded balloons.11. The lighter-than-air craft of claim 1 wherein the balloons held by a system of cables, fitted to hooks on the horizontal cross-overs of the framework on being filled with a calculated quantity of decompressed lighter-than-air gas are used to reduce gradually the weight of the craft, of the loaded material and of the passengers and neutralize the earth attraction exerted on the craft and its load which can then be lifted in the air with the thrust of the vertical propellents.12. The lighter-than-air craft of claim 1 wherein the cabin is placed behind the vertical pylons of the framework,the cabin platform is set on the horizontal cross-overs and the diagonal cross sections held at the centre by a system of vertical beams supporting both the bottom level of the passenger compartment and the bottom level of the machine compartment of the framework; the overall structure is carried by a suspension system on wheels for ground movement and/or by a system of inflatable and retractable balloon-bags for sea landings; the windows fitted to the lateral balustrade are bulletproof; and, the secured cabin openings, for embarkation and disembarkation of passengers, are positioned at the rear of the cabin.
